Nolay is situated in the south of the Coted'or just 20 minutes from Beaune with its historic hospice situated within the ramparts, chic boutiques, and great wine houses where you can reserve a wine tasting. Also on the limits of Saone et Loire, 25 minutes to Autun, a town with lots of Roman ruins, also a school for the military. Seeped in history over the decades. Chalon sur Saone with the river running through its centre, choice of shops, restaurants, cafes and lots of different events throughout the year. Dijon the capital of the Dukes of Burgundy. with museums, monuments, cathedrals ect, ect. A region with a great choice of Chateaux and ancient abbeys. A good place to visit.
